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ente | ||
diaporama_fond_d_ecran [Le 25/07/2016, 11:06] 79.87.128.191 [Mettre en place le diaporama] |
diaporama_fond_d_ecran [Le 27/11/2022, 01:33] (Version actuelle) Coeur Noir [Manuellement] |
||
---|---|---|---|
Ligne 2: | Ligne 2: | ||
- | ====== Ajouter des diaporamas aux fonds d'écran de GNOME ====== | + | ====== Ajouter des diaporamas de fond d'écran avec GNOME ====== |
- | + | <note tip>Ce tutoriel a pour but de vous permettre de rajouter vos propres diaporamas comme fond d'écran pour obtenir un rendu similaire aux deux déjà présents par défaut. </note> | |
- | <note tip>Ce tutoriel a pour but de vous permettre de rajouter vos propres diaporamas comme fond d'écran pour obtenir le même rendu que les deux présents par défaut. </note> | + | ===== Méthodes graphiques ===== |
- | <note tip>Si vous voulez faire un diaporama de fond d'écran simplement et graphiquement, sans avoir à suivre ce long, fastidieux et pas toujours très fonctionnel tutoriel, utilisez Shotwell (installé par défaut): | + | ==== Avec Shotwell ==== |
- | + | Faire un diaporama avec [[shotwell|Shotwell]] (installé par défault) est très simple. | |
- | - Importez vos photos/images | + | - Importez vos photos/images |
- | + | - Sélectionnez celles que vous voulez mettre en diaporama | |
- | - Sélectionnez celles que vous voulez mettre en diaporama | + | - Fichier -> Définir comme diaporama de fond d'écran |
- | + | - Choisissez la durée entre chaque image, les écrans concernés (votre bureau et/ou l'écran de verrouillage), et le tour est joué ! | |
- | - Fichier -> Definir comme diaporama de fond d'écran | + | <note tip> la liste des images et des transitions est enregistrée dans le fichier: ~/.local/share/shotwell/wallpaper/wallpaper.xml</note> |
- | + | <note>Si vous changez accidentellement le fond d'écran il faudra tout refaire :-/ ou modifier vous-même le fichier wallpaper.xml référencé ci-dessus</note> | |
- | - Choisissez la durée entre chaque image, et le tour est joué ! </note> | + | |
===== Créer votre diaporama ===== | ===== Créer votre diaporama ===== | ||
==== Regrouper vos photos ==== | ==== Regrouper vos photos ==== | ||
- | <note tip>Il n'est pas obligatoire de réunir tous les éléments du diaporama, mais cela permet de garder une bonne organisation dans votre disque </note> | + | <note tip>Ce n'est pas obligatoire de réunir tous les éléments du diaporama, mais cela permet de garder une bonne organisation dans votre disque. </note> |
- | Créer un répertoire à l'emplacement de votre choix, par exemple dans votre dossier personnel Images ( ~/Images ) | + | Créer un répertoire à l'emplacement de votre choix, par exemple un répertoire Diapo dans votre dossier personnel Images ( ~/Images ). |
- | Placez-y l'ensemble des photos nécessaires au diaporama | + | Placez-y l'ensemble des photos nécessaires au diaporama. |
==== Configurer le diaporama ==== | ==== Configurer le diaporama ==== | ||
- | Une fois fait, dans le même dossier créer un fichier xml basé sur ce modèle : | + | Dans ce même dossier Diapo, créer un fichier xml basé sur ce modèle : |
- | <code> | + | <code xml> |
<background> | <background> | ||
- | <starttime><!-- Ne fonctionne pas a premiere vue, le mieux est de le laisser --> | + | <starttime><!-- Date de début du fonctionnement du diaporama (mettre simplement une date antérieure au jour de création) --> |
- | <year>2009</year> | + | <year>2017</year> |
- | <month>08</month> | + | <month>01</month> |
- | <day>04</day> | + | <day>01</day> |
<hour>00</hour> | <hour>00</hour> | ||
<minute>00</minute> | <minute>00</minute> | ||
Ligne 40: | Ligne 39: | ||
<!-- Debut du diaporama --> | <!-- Debut du diaporama --> | ||
<static> | <static> | ||
- | <duration>1795.0</duration> <!-- temps pendant le quel cette image est affichee --> | + | <duration>1795.0</duration> <!-- temps pendant lequel cette image est affichée (en secondes) --> |
- | <file>/home/oly/Documents/test-diapo/1.png</file> <!-- lien vers l'image (lien complet a partir de la racine du systeme) --> | + | <file>/home/moi/Images/Diapo/1.png</file> <!-- lien vers l'image (lien complet a partir de la racine du système) --> |
</static> | </static> | ||
<transition> | <transition> | ||
- | <duration>5.0</duration> <!-- durée de l'effet de transition --> | + | <duration>5.0</duration> <!-- durée de l'effet de transition (en secondes)--> |
- | <from>/home/oly/Documents/test-diapo/1.png</from> <!-- lien vers l'image en cours (lien complet a partir de la racine du systeme) --> | + | <from>/home/moi/Images/Diapo/1.png</from> <!-- lien vers l'image en cours (lien complet a partir de la racine du systeme) --> |
- | <to>/home/oly/Documents/test-diapo/2.jpg</to> <!-- lien vers l'image suivante (lien complet a partir de la racine du systeme) --> | + | <to>/home/moi/Images/Diapo/2.jpg</to> <!-- lien vers l'image suivante (lien complet a partir de la racine du systeme) --> |
</transition> | </transition> | ||
- | <static> | + | <static> |
<duration>1795.0</duration> <!-- temps pendant le quel cette image est affichee --> | <duration>1795.0</duration> <!-- temps pendant le quel cette image est affichee --> | ||
- | <file>/home/oly/Documents/test-diapo/2.jpg</file> <!-- lien vers l'image --> | + | <file>/home/moi/Images/Diapo/2.jpg</file> <!-- lien vers l'image --> |
</static> | </static> | ||
- | <transition> | + | <transition> |
- | <duration>5.0</duration> <!-- durée de l'éffet de transition --> | + | <duration>5.0</duration> <!-- durée de l'effet de transition --> |
- | <from>/home/oly/Documents/test-diapo/2.jpg</from> <!-- lien vers l'image en cours (lien complet a partir de la racine du systeme) --> | + | <from>/home/moi/Images/Diapo/2.jpg</from> <!-- lien vers l'image en cours (lien complet a partir de la racine du systeme) --> |
- | <to>/home/oly/Documents/test-diapo/1.png</to> <!-- lien vers la premiere image (lien complet a partir de la racine du systeme) --> | + | <to>/home/moi/Images/Diapo/1.png</to> <!-- lien vers la premiere image (lien complet a partir de la racine du systeme) --> |
</transition> | </transition> | ||
- | |||
</background> | </background> | ||
- | |||
</code> | </code> | ||
- | Il faut donc simplement suivre ce schéma et finir par fermer la boucle avec une transition vers l'image de début. | + | Pour avoir une transition de type "recouvrement", on peut utiliser <transition type="overlay"> au lieu de simplement <transition> |
+ | |||
+ | Pour avoir un diaporama fonctionnel, il faut simplement suivre ce schéma et finir par fermer la boucle avec une transition vers l'image de début. | ||
+ | |||
+ | Ensuite, enregistrez ce fichier (avec l'extension .xml) dans votre dossier Diapo. | ||
- | Ensuite, enregistrez ce fichier dans le dossier avec comme nom : *******.xml | ||
- | ( Vous devez bien sûr remplacer * ****** par le nom de votre choix. ) | ||
===== Mettre en place le diaporama ===== | ===== Mettre en place le diaporama ===== | ||
- | Une fois que votre diaporama est créé il va falloir l'indiquer au gestionnaire de fond d'écran de GNOME | + | Une fois que votre diaporama est créé il va falloir l'indiquer au gestionnaire de fond d'écran de GNOME. |
- | Pour cela, placez-vous dans ce dossier : <code> cd /usr/share/gnome-background-properties </code> | + | ==== Avec Gnome Tweak Tool ==== |
- | puis, [[:tutoriel:comment_modifier_un_fichier|créer avec les droits super-utilisateur]] le fichier mon_diaporama.xml | + | |
+ | Dans l'outil de personnalisation Gnome, dans la catégorie "Bureau", cliquez sur le bouton correspondant à "Emplacement de l'arrière-plan". | ||
+ | Sélectionnez votre fichier .xml, et validez. | ||
+ | |||
+ | ==== Manuellement ==== | ||
+ | |||
+ | Placez-vous dans ce dossier : <code> cd /usr/share/gnome-background-properties </code> | ||
+ | puis, [[:tutoriel:comment_modifier_un_fichier|créez avec les droits super-utilisateur]] le fichier mon_diaporama.xml | ||
Ce fichier doit être similaire à ce modèle : | Ce fichier doit être similaire à ce modèle : | ||
- | <code> | + | <file xml> |
<?xml version="1.0" encoding="UTF-8"?> | <?xml version="1.0" encoding="UTF-8"?> | ||
<!DOCTYPE wallpapers SYSTEM "gnome-wp-list.dtd"> | <!DOCTYPE wallpapers SYSTEM "gnome-wp-list.dtd"> | ||
<wallpapers> | <wallpapers> | ||
<wallpaper deleted="false"> | <wallpaper deleted="false"> | ||
- | | ||
<name>Test</name> <!-- Nom du diaporama --> | <name>Test</name> <!-- Nom du diaporama --> | ||
<name xml:lang="fr">test</name> <!-- Nom du diaporama dans une langue --> | <name xml:lang="fr">test</name> <!-- Nom du diaporama dans une langue --> | ||
Ligne 88: | Ligne 93: | ||
</wallpaper> | </wallpaper> | ||
</wallpapers> | </wallpapers> | ||
- | </code> | + | |
+ | </file> | ||
Et enregistrez le fichier. | Et enregistrez le fichier. | ||
- | Les valeurs admissibles pour les options d'affichage du diaporama "<options>XXXXXX</options>" sont : tile (répéter en mosaïque jusqu'à remplir l'écran), zoom, center (centrer sans modification de taille), scale, fill (remplir pour adapter la taille au bord le plus court) ou span. Omettre la ligne permet de choisir l'option directement dans l'interface utilisateur (clic droit bureau -> Modifier l'arrière plan du bureau). | + | Les valeurs admissibles pour les options d'affichage du diaporama "<options>XXXXXX</options>" sont : |
- | ===== Création du diaporama et mise en place du diaporama de façon automatique ===== | + | * tile (répéter en mosaïque jusqu'à remplir l'écran), |
- | + | * zoom, | |
- | Le logiciel pour la création automatique du script montré plus haut possède certaines contraintes : | + | * center (centrer sans modification de taille), |
- | * toutes les images doivent être dans un dossier précis ; | + | * scale, |
- | * avoir des noms allant de 1 en 1 et le premier doit être le numéro 1 (1.png, 2.png, 3.png, etc.) ; | + | * fill (remplir pour adapter la taille au bord le plus court), |
- | * elles doivent toutes avoir la même extension (.png, .jpg, etc.). | + | * ou span. |
- | + | ||
- | Voici le lien de téléchargement. | + | |
- | + | ||
- | [[http://dl.dropbox.com/u/29537367/fondEcranAutomatique|Téléchargement]] | + | |
- | ===== Conclusion ===== | + | |
- | + | ||
- | Voila, il ne reste plus qu'à le sélectionner dans le gestionnaire de fond d'écran. | + | |
- | + | ||
- | N'oubliez pas que SHOTWELL permet aussi d'ajouter un diaporama simple à votre fonds d'écran, il suffit pour cela d'importer un dossier dans le menu Fichier, de sélectionner toutes les images (Ctrl+A), puis Définir comme Diaporama d'écran (Menu Fichier). | + | |
- | Il reste à préciser la durée d'affichage de chaque photo et le tour est joué | + | |
+ | Omettre la ligne permet de choisir l'option directement dans l'interface utilisateur (clic droit bureau -> Modifier l'arrière plan du bureau). | ||
+ | <note tip>Quelques essais testés sous Ubuntu 22.04 et 22.10 [[https://forum.ubuntu-fr.org/viewtopic.php?pid=22623292#p22623292|par là]].</note> | ||
---- | ---- | ||
- | //Contributeurs principaux : [[:utilisateurs:Oly]].// | + | //Contributeurs principaux : [[:utilisateurs:Oly]], Roschan.// |